- Job Summary: This position is responsible for providing instruction and serving as advisor to students enrolled in the Industrial Mechanic/Millwright Program each semester and may include summer assignments.
- Associate's degree in a related post-secondary or professional-technical education program and six (6) years of recent experience in an area related to the needs of the position OR
- Must achieve related Idaho CTE Postsecondary Limited Occupational Specialist Certification within first 12 months of employment.
- Strong skills in equipment installation, precision leveling & alignment, alignment of rotating equipment, pipefitting, valves, lubrication practices, maintenance of precision bearings, and maintenance of gear, chain, and belt drives.
- Knowledge of thread systems, fasteners, critical tightening and torque.
